The debate about skins in games like CSGO (Counter-Strike: Global Offensive) often revolves around aesthetics, but the implications run deeper than mere visual appeal. Players frequently report that equipping a rare or uniquely designed skin enhances their sense of identity within the game and can significantly impact their confidence. This sentiment is supported by various psychological studies that highlight the concept of 'enclothed cognition,' which suggests that the clothing or gear we wear can influence our psychological state and behavior. In the context of CSGO, a visually striking weapon skin may not only increase a player's enjoyment but also enhance their performance as they feel an attachment to their virtual arsenal.
